Puréed food

Hello! I had the sleeve 1/15. I’m wondering: I’m just starting puréed foods. Can I have guacamole or retried beans? Maybe even some cheese mixed in? What are some puréed foods you guys had that are good?

I started purees a couple days ago. Haven't tried them yet, but my plan has fat free refried beans on the list of recommended foods. Just make sure to puree them - they recommend maybe thinning them out a little.

I've tried a scrambled egg twice. Takes me a long time to finish it. I love cottage cheese, so have had that (did NOT like it with protein powder mixed in) and it goes down well. Have also had chicken salad made with canned chicken and greek yogurt, whirled in the blender. Today will try some roasted red pepper and tomato soup with unflavored protein powder.

I’m 2 weeks post op and in the puréed stage too. I’ve had refried beans with melted cheese. I also added a little plain Greek yogurt to it. It’s a great sour cream substitute. I puréed the beans first and thinned them out just a little with water. It taste great!


My other favorite right now is puréed clam chowder. I found yummy chowder in the refrigerated section of Trader Joe’s.
